Labour Day Classic

Yesterday I covered the Annual Labour Day Classic at McMahon Stadium. There was an extra pass and although I am done at the Herald I talked to photo editor Peter Brosseau when we were out on the golf course the other day and he was fine with me taking a pass. I ended up getting front page sports with the first and last pictures of this post. It was a great game and 35,744 fans showed up this Labour Day to cheer their Stampeders to a 44-23 victory in the 30 degree heat. Anyways, here are a selection of the photos I took at the game.
